|
jDiffChaser has been created by our development team working on a collaborative environmental data software for an air traffic control company. The software (in production since 2005) displays a lot of information grouped on many panels viewed by controllers who can have many roles. Such a software emphasizes the importance of chosen fonts, colors and components visual behaviors because each of those graphical information has a business meaning and can be contextual, depending on roles. That's why it is as much important to test the content as to test the visual aspect of what is displayed, in order to avoid what we used to call “visual regression”. We, responsible for this application, decided to create a tool to help doing this checking because we didn't find any existing package to do so as traditional GUI testing tool were not dedicated to such a task.
|